The University of North Carolina at Pembroke is a public university located in Pembroke, North Carolina, founded in 1887. Known for its strong commitment to Native American heritage and diverse student body, it is recognized for its inclusive and supportive community. The university's mascot is a spirited BraveHawk, symbolizing strength and unity.

Historical Tuition Costs

Based on historical data, in-state tuition is expected to rise by approximately $79 per year over the next three years, reaching $4,755 in 2024, and $4,833 in 2025, and $4,912 in 2026.

Admissions

University of North Carolina at Pembroke admissions is not very selective with an acceptance rate of 90%. The application deadline can be found on the institution's website.
